2 · Repository & workflow decisions
Decision | Rationale |
---|---|
Work stays in an OOT module (gr-incubator ) |
Keeps GR-4.0 mainline clean until merge week. |
Initial folder skeleton will be scaffolded by Josh | Gives everyone a stable starting point. |
Ralph’s “multi-header-in-one-file” style accepted | Easier to locate related templates; reduces header churn. |
3 · Naming-convention consensus
Rule | Agreed behaviour |
---|---|
Block class names | PascalCase, e.g. IIRFilter , MultiplyConst . |
File names | Descriptive, no underscores; e.g. IIRFilter.(hpp|cpp) . |
Parentheses in filenames | Use only where GR-4.0 already does (Foo(simd).hpp )—signals SIMD specialisations without underscores. |
Avoid one-word abbreviations | Helps users grep by intent rather than internal shorthand. |
John Sally favoured 1:1 file–class mapping; Ralph preferred “logical grouping”. Both agreed underscore-free names make discovery simpler.

5 · Port-order roadmap
- Math (block family already underway)
- ZMQ (critical for network demos)
- Filters (FIR/IIR, complex variants)
- Analog → Digital → the rest (as originally proposed)
